It's hard to get clean lines because of bleeding. But if your wax isn't hot enough the next layer wont adhere. Try pouring a thin layer of wax, then let it cool, to act as a protective layer to prevent bleeding. After that cools, pour your next layer. HTH

The wax is IGI 2778 palm pillar wax from Let It Shine. Peak has the same wax.
I used liquid sage green in one pot and no color in another. I started out with no color, then added 2 drops for the next pour. I wanted more white, so I went to the second pour pot. For the next pour of green, I added another drop of sage green. The no colored one was used for the very last pour.

It's the only base I use. Haven't had any problems with it. I add shea butter, coconut oil, jojoba oil, and palm stearic acid to mine.
I get a nice hard bar of soap with lots of creamy lather.
